Obnoxiously loud pipes that like to squeal and hammer are easy situations to correct. You must anchor any type of exposed pipe. You may need the assistance of a professional in the case that the pipes are contained within a floor or ceiling. If you have a water pipe that freezes, have the tap closest to it turned on so the water can exit while the pipe thaws. This will help relieve pressure in pipes to prevent them from bursting, which may prevent bigger damage for your home. Sifting drainers are available for any size drain to prevent items larger than a grain of sand going into your pipes. Kitchen sink strainers should be cleaned every time they collect large food particles. You should clean out the strainer in your bathtub often. Never try to fix a garbage disposal by putting your hand down into it. Garbage disposals are not healthy places for hands to be, even if they are not running. Go online and search for sketch of your disposal, or a troubleshooter. You should always put plenty of cold water through your garbage disposal while it is running. The cold water will help keep the blades nice and sharp and will allow for a much smoother disposal. Hot water will liquefy grease and build up inside the drain, eventually causing clogs. Choose enzyme based cleaners if your pipes get clogged. Enzyme-based cleaners actually digest part of the sludge, liquefying it, and cleaning your drain naturally. Cleaners containing enzymes are some of the best you can buy. You can keep your bathtub pipes clear by pouring baking soda and vinegar down your drain once a month. Use one cup of each. Cover the drain with a plug or rag as you wait for the chemical reaction between the vinegar and baking soda to happen in your pipes. After waiting a few minutes, flush the drain with boiling water. This method should clear your pipes of accumulated hair and soap scum. Use cold water when using your garbage disposal. Cold water will allow for the food particles to be properly disposed of while keeping the blades sharp. Hot water liquifies grease and causes it to buildup in the drain, causing clogs in the pipes. As the weather is becoming colder due to the coming of winter, be sure that your external faucets donot have leaks or drips. If you find a problem, you need to move quickly to repair it, lest the faucetcrack. Regardless of whether you have steel, plastic or copper pipes, the water in them expandswhen it freezes and will make the pipes crack. Even the tiniest of cracks can release enough water tocause water damage or flooding to your home.

There are two easy methods to removing a stubborn clean-out plug. The first method involves ahammer and chisel to loosen the fitting. Your only other choice is chiseling directly through theactual plug itself.

You can research a plumber online, even if you did not choose them. Though your insurer maydetermine the plumbing company that will work on your house, you still have the ability to look themup, read customer reviews and prepare for their visit.

Choose a drain cleaner wisely. Some have chemicalsthat are harmful, and may damage your pipes. Choosea drain cleaner that is well-known and whose labelsays it will not harm pipes. Some chemicals can killthe beneficial bacteria in your pipes which are neededso your plumbing system can work correctly.Additionally, some of these chemical can also bedangerous to you and your family.

Sometimes you might find that your drainage pipe for the washing machine might overflow. Everynow and then, lint and other tiny washing machine items can build within the pipe, which can causeit to back up or clog.

Write down all of your problems and questions to take care of when your plumber visits to save youvaluable time and money. Establish a list of all the things that need to be checked before theplumber gets here. This way, there's only one charge for the service, instead of the plumber needingto make multiple trips.

A water heater that has no tank is a good choice for those that are conservation-minded. In contrastto conventional water heaters, these appliances only heat the water when it is needed rather thanstoring hot water in a tank. If you just heat water on demand, it can greatly save you in heatingcosts!

Everyone who lives in your home should know where to find the shut off valves to water sources. If asituation arises where the water needs to be cut off it is important for everyone tohttp://www.popularmechanics.com/home/how-to/a3685/4287807/ be able to do it, so that it can bedone in a timely manner and ultimately reduce the amount of damage that is caused from theflooding water. They will be able to stop the water from flowing if they know how to shut it off.
